• Privacywetgeving
    Het is bij Helpmij.nl niet toegestaan om persoonsgegevens in een voorbeeld te plaatsen. Alle voorbeelden die persoonsgegevens bevatten zullen zonder opgaaf van reden verwijderd worden. In de vraag zal specifiek vermeld moeten worden dat het om fictieve namen gaat.

Cijfers veranderen in lijst

Status
Niet open voor verdere reacties.

dommeltje

Gebruiker
Lid geworden
16 dec 2007
Berichten
26
Ik heb een hele lijst met getallen van 1 tot en met 60.
Nu is het de bedoeling dat alles boven de 10 word weergegeven als >10

Bij voorbaat dank
 
dommeltje,

Zo iets?
Code:
Private Sub Worksheet_SelectionChange(ByVal Target As Range)
  For Each cl In Range("A1:A25")
    If cl > 10 Then
      cl.Value = ">10"
    End If
  Next
End Sub
 
Of deze
Code:
Sub tst()
    sq = [Blad1!A1:A60]
        For i = 1 To UBound(sq)
            sq(i, 1) = IIf(sq(i, 1) > 10, ">10", sq(i, 1))
        Next
    [Blad1!A1].Resize(UBound(sq)) = sq
End Sub
Voordeel is dat deze niet bij elke celwissel getriggerd wordt.
 
Status
Niet open voor verdere reacties.
Terug
Bovenaan Onderaan